Abstract

 供給液の評価が可能であると共に、逆浸透膜に生じるスケール等の問題をより直接的に監視することができる膜分離方法および膜分離装置を提供する。 供給液を供給して透過液と濃縮液とを得る逆浸透膜モジュール3を備える膜分離装置において、膜面11aが監視可能な分離膜11を有し、供給液を導いて膜分離を行う供給側膜分離手段10と、膜面21aが監視可能な分離膜21を有し、濃縮液を導いて膜分離を行う濃縮側膜分離手段20とを設けたことを特徴とする。
